Witryna11 sie 2024 · Youth & COVID-19: Impacts on jobs, education, rights and mental well-being. The report captures the immediate effects of the pandemic on the lives of young people (aged 18–29) with regards to employment, education, mental well-being, rights and social activism. Over 12,000 responses were received from young people in 112 …
